Vista not recognising Sata Hard drives

    I bought a few things of hardwareversand for a new build.
    Namely 2 Mator diamond max 22 500 GB and a Gigabyte GA-P31-S3G with the hope of setting up a raid 0.
    I now think that my mobo doesn’t do raid.

    First I couldn't vista on either one. So I installed vista 64bit on an old 160 GB ide HD. Vista only seems to find one hard drive.
    The set up now is Ide HD master 1, ide DVD slave1, sata HD master 2, sata HD master 3.
    I’ve got the newest bios, installed all the updates. But can’t boot Maxtor maxblast because it doesn’t recognise any of the hds as Maxtor.

    I really don’t have a clue.

    Checked the mobo website and it recommends installed HD drivers and the Maxtor website says that I have to install the mobo drivers.
    I'm getting no where...

    Any suggestions?

    you will need to slipstream the operating system cd to include the sata controllers drivers

    Try using nlite for this , its free to download and should do what you need it to do
